In statistics, the standard deviation is a measure of the amount of variation or dispersion of a set of values. It is the square root of the variance. The standard deviation is a measure of how spread out numbers are. From a statistics standpoint, the standard deviation of a dataset is a measure of the magnitude of deviations between the values of the observations contained in the dataset.
